Output ec6460691766c7e13f72ef1a96cc7d8016e18cb062ed266e6b88a986c84e3244:1

value
44649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1111a3483f9e02616e76b3d64ad992b079834e OP_EQUAL
address
3HHXvKCSTNywzR836prRGbqYPsFqqzjh46
transaction
ec6460691766c7e13f72ef1a96cc7d8016e18cb062ed266e6b88a986c84e3244
confirmations
267789
spent
true